H2: The Physical Foundation of Meditation

A still mind begins with a comfortable body. Tension in the shoulders, tight hips, or shallow breathing interrupt focus. Gentle stretching and hydration before meditation prepare the body to stay present. Balanced nutrition also influences mental clarity; too much caffeine or sugar can make thoughts race.

H2: Creating the Ideal Meditation Space

Environment shapes focus. A quiet corner with soft lighting, clean air, and minimal clutter invites stillness. A drop of essential oil or a burning candle adds sensory depth. Green plants contribute freshness and remind you to breathe slowly.

H2: Techniques to Deepen Awareness

Start with short sessions and extend gradually. Focus on the breath without judgment. When distractions appear, acknowledge them and return attention to inhalation and exhalation. Pairing these techniques with calming herbal teas prepares the body to settle naturally into concentration.
